The Mysore pure silk saree with pure zari gives it a natural sheen and rich texture. The Mysore silk sarees are manufactured in Karnataka - one of the largest 'mulberry silk' producers in the country.

This gorgeous saree is in dark chocolate with magenta border and Zari work. Pallu is black with Zari lines. The saree has magenta running blouse piece. The saree is Pure Silk with a 'Silk Mark'.

Care instructions: The saree is made using natural dyes and extracts. Variations in weave texture, colours and print may occur in hand-made products. Irrespective of fabric type, we would recommend that you dry clean only.

Care Guide

Always dry wash your silk and linen sarees.
Never hand-wash or machine-wash your silk or linen saree.
In case the saree gets stained, immediately wipe the stain off with cold water.
Store the saree in a light cotton muslin cloth. This will give the saree breathing space and will prevent one saree from sticking to another when kept in a pile.
Don’t store the saree in a plastic cover as this will cause the gold embroidery to turn black.
